About GILHX

Guggenheim Limited Duration Fund is designed to provide investors with a diversified portfolio primarily composed of debt securities and related financial instruments. The fund operates within the asset management industry, focusing on fixed-income investments. The fund invests at least 80% of its assets in debt securities, financial instruments that perform similarly to debt securities, investment vehicles that provide exposure to debt securities, and debt-like securities. These investments include individual securities, investment vehicles, and derivatives that offer exposure to fixed-income markets. The fund's strategy involves constructing a portfolio that balances income generation with risk management. By diversifying across various debt instruments, the fund seeks to mitigate the impact of interest rate fluctuations and credit risk. The fund's investment approach is geared towards investors seeking a stable income stream with a lower risk profile compared to equity investments. The fund's investment decisions are guided by Guggenheim's team of investment professionals, who conduct thorough research and analysis to identify attractive opportunities in the fixed-income market. The fund's objective is to provide consistent returns while preserving capital, making it a suitable option for investors with a moderate risk tolerance.

What are the main risks for GILHX?

The main risks for Guggenheim Limited Duration Fund include interest rate risk, credit risk, and market risk. Rising interest rates could negatively impact the value of the fund's bond holdings, while credit risk refers to the possibility that issuers of debt securities may default on their obligations. Market risk encompasses broader economic and geopolitical factors that could affect the overall performance of the fixed-income market. Additionally, the fund's use of derivatives could introduce additional risks, such as counterparty risk and liquidity risk. Effective risk management is crucial for mitigating these potential challenges and protecting investor capital.
